89 Golf 15k miles since swap
Drivetrain:
1996 OBD2 GTI 120k 2.8L VR6
Chains Done With Swap
Autotech 262's
Autotech Q-chip
New lifters
MK IV Metal Headgasket
Valve Guides, Surfaced Head, New Seals
New Crack Pipe and Thermostat Housing
New Water Pump
VF Trans Mount
Techtonics Cat Back Exhaust w/Borla
New Coil Pack
Non-A/C Serpentine Conversion, New Belt and Tensioner
Trans:
1996 GTI O2A 5 speed
Autotech Steel L/W Flywheel
New Clutch and all Hydraulics
New Drive Axles
TM tuning Short Shifter
Brakes:
Corrado G60 11" Girling 54mm Calipers
New Power Slot Rotors
Akebono Ceramic Pads
Techtonics Stainless Steel Lines
Suspension/Wheels:
Narrow Front Subframe
TT Control Arm Position Bushings
Koni Yellow Struts
Neuspeed Springs
Autotech Rear sway bar
ESM 009's 15x8 et10 all around
